THE PRESIDENT'S XI - MATCH DETAILS - WANDERERS

THE PRESIDENT'S XI
CRICKET CLUB

v. WANDERERS
24 MAY 1986


WON BY TWO WICKETS
GAYMER'S MATCH


Our fourth full season - but the first match of which we still have a record - and a classic low-scoring game. The Wanderers opened steadily - but the bowlers dominate. Stefan Tevis opens with a spell of seven overs for just ten runs - but the first wicket does not fall until the tenth over. It's 32-1. Jerry Williams come on to take two in his first two overs. It's 40-3 after fifteen overs. Clark and Taylor go cheaply and it's 43-5. Barns is soon run out - but Dunmore starts to find the boundary. When he finally falls to Leslie Hines for 45 in the thirty-first over the score stands at 98-8. The tail adds a handful more - but the Presidents restrict the score to just 113-9 off thirty-five full overs.

We reply - and start with disaster. Laurence Worms run out for nothing. Rob Raeburn caught behind for one. It's 3-2 at the end of the third over. Gordon Sheridan and Florian Eames start to rebuild - but it's slow going. When Gordon falls in the 10th over it's 21-3. Stefan Tevis and Jerry Williams for once both fail to reach double figures. Florian soldiers on - but the fifty does not come up until the twentieth over. Then comes the stand of the match - Florian and Leslie take us to ninety-five - but then Leslie goes for 24 (including the only six of the match). At the end of the thirtieth over it's 96-6 and the bowlers are on top.

Just a single from the next over - 97-6. Two more runs from the next - but Florian finally falls for a hard-fought 39 - and Guy Martin goes four balls later. It's 99-8 and just three overs remain. The frugal Clark comes back - but concedes six including three precious wides. Just two runs from the next - 107-8 - and seven still needed off the last over.

Steve Gaymer to face Dunmore, whose figures off his first six overs are 2-12. He's just accounted for Florian and Guy. But two off the first ball - two more off the second - two again off the third - and the scores are level. You could hear a pin drop. Smack - it's four - and Steve has seen us home with two balls to spare. "That man!" says the scorebook in a jubilant aside.
